Synopsis

Middle schoolers Mirai and Emo launch their own Pri☆Chan channel to become self-produced idols.

First-year middle school girls Mirai Momoyama and Emo Moegi are two aspiring idols who decide to use the "Pri☆Chan System," a system used by famous people and companies to broadcast content. Like many girls starting their own channels and uploading content, the pair decide to become their own producers, starting their own channel in an attempt to become Pri☆Chan idols. (Source: ANN)
